Side effect(s) of Thiopental


Review the side-effects of Thiopental as documented in medical literature. The term "side effects" refers to unintended effects that can occur as a result of taking the medication. In majority of the instances these side-effects are mild and easily tolerable, however sometimes they can be more severe and can be detrimental.

If the side effects are not tolerable adjusting the dosage or switching to a different medication can help to manage or overcome side effects. If you have any doubts or questions, we recommend seeking advice from your doctor or pharmacist.

  Most Common
- Respiratory depression, heart attack, irregular heart rate, drowsiness, sneezing, coughing, asthma and shivering.

  Allergic Reactions
- Hives, itching and swelling.

Drug Name : Thiopental

Thiopental(Pentothal) generic is a barbiturate general anesthetic, prescribed for induction of anesthesia. It depresses the central nervous system, causing mild sleep.
